1. Is MANN-FILTER the same as MANN+HUMMEL?
Yes. MANN-FILTER is the aftermarket parts brand of the MANN+HUMMEL Group. Same engineering teams, same plants, same test labs—different label on the box. Because MANN+HUMMEL is a major original-equipment filter supplier, the parts that carry the MANN-FILTER name are built to the same production part approval process required by the OEM contracts.
That doesn't mean every filter with the logo is identical to the factory part. Some are direct OE-service parts; others are service solutions that match flow and efficiency but use a different housing. Either way, the spec has to match the original. I've seen buyers match the product photo instead of the part number and order the wrong solution entirely. Read the catalog notes, and check the OEM reference number printed on the filter housing.
2. Will a MANN+HUMMEL oil filter cross-reference with Donaldson?
Usually, yes—with a big "it depends." Donaldson makes strong filters, and MANN+HUMMEL makes strong filters. A cross-reference is valid when both parts share the same thread size, gasket diameter, bypass valve setting, and media efficiency. If the bypass valve opens at a different pressure, the part will spin on and still be wrong for the application.
I learned this the hard way. I told a supplier, "send me the equivalent cross-reference," and they heard, "send me something that fits this thread." The thread matched. The bypass valve didn't—it opened pretty much 10 psi earlier than the OEM spec. That quality issue cost us a $22,000 redo and delayed our customer's launch.
The fix is to use a real cross-reference database, either Donaldson's own lookup or the MANN+HUMMEL catalog, and compare test specs rather than dimensions. In an IATF 16949-certified plant, each part number goes through a documented production part approval process. Ask your supplier for that documentation.
3. Is the MANN HU 7025z the right oil filter for the Mercedes OM654?
For most OM654 applications, yes—the HU 7025z is the filter specified for that engine family. But the part number alone isn't enough. Mercedes revised the oil filter housing and cap at some point during the OM654's production life, and the seal kit for early housings differs from later ones. I don't have the production break memorized, so I won't quote it here. Check the VIN against the Mercedes parts system before ordering.
I say this from experience. We had a fleet order—50 units, two hours to decide because the customer's schedule was already blown. The catalog said HU 7025z for OM654, so I skipped the VIN check. In hindsight, I should have pushed back and asked for production dates. Eighteen of those filters leaked past the cap seal within a week of install. Now every filter contract I review includes a VIN-verification step.
4. Why is the bottom radiator hose such a big deal?
Because it's the part that never gets replaced until it fails. The bottom radiator hose sits lower than the top hose, so it sees the same heat plus more contamination—oil drips, road grime, and sediment that settles in the cooling system. Over time the inner rubber breaks down and the hose can collapse at highway RPM, starving the water pump of coolant. That's how an overheating issue turns into a blown head gasket.
When I review cooling-system service specs, I flag the hose if it hasn't been replaced within the same service interval as the radiator or thermostat. 5. Is the "Honeywell thermostat app" for my car?
Not the one you're thinking of. The Honeywell thermostat app that dominates search results is a home HVAC app—for your house, not your vehicle. Honeywell is a huge, diversified company, and automotive thermostats are mechanical or electronically controlled valves. There's no app that controls them.
What you likely need is an OBD-II scanner with a live-data app that reads engine coolant temperature. That's the closest thing to a "thermostat app" that matters under the hood. You can watch the temperature curve: if it climbs slowly and never stabilizes, the thermostat is suspect; if it spikes under load and drops fast, you're probably dealing with a flow restriction or a collapsing bottom radiator hose.
So if you're searching for a thermostat app because the car runs hot, the app won't fix it. Check the thermostat, the hoses, and the coolant level first—and verify the replacement thermostat against your engine code.
6. How much does a head gasket replacement cost?
Don't hold me to exact figures, but as of January 2025 you should budget roughly $1,500 to $3,000 on a typical mainstream vehicle. The gasket itself is often $50–$200. The labor is the big line item: the shop has to disassemble the top end, measure the cylinder head for warpage, resurface it if necessary, and sometimes deal with timing components that sit in the way. I've seen book times in the 8-to-12-hour range for a transverse four-cylinder, and shop labor rates in many regions sit between $110 and $160 an hour. Do the math and you'll see why the part is never the expensive part.
On a modern diesel like the Mercedes OM654, expect the higher end of that range or beyond because the packaging is tight and parts cost more. The mistake I keep seeing in quality reviews is fixing the gasket without fixing the reason it failed. If the car overheated because a radiator hose collapsed or a thermostat stuck, the new gasket is on borrowed time. That's how a $2,000 repair becomes a $4,000 repair inside a year. Check the whole cooling system while the head is off.
7. Is a cheaper filter just as good?
Here's my honest position after years of reviewing specs: the brand matters less than the spec. A mid-priced filter with the correct bypass valve, anti-drainback valve, and media efficiency will protect an engine perfectly well. What hurts people is cross-referencing by thread size alone, or matching the photo instead of the part number.
That said, don't save $8 on a part that takes an hour of labor to replace. If the filter carries OEM approval with an original-equipment reference number—like the MANN-FILTER parts that match factory filters—the extra few dollars are cheap insurance.
